View Poll Results: What Chip/Programmer are you using in your 7.3L Powerstroke?
Superchips Microtuner 78 26.26%
Edge Juice/Att Monitor 23 7.74%
Edge Evolution 45 15.15%
Bullydog Power Pup 10 3.37%
Bullydog Dyno Dominator 1 0.34%
Bullydog 4Bank Chip 10 3.37%
Diablosport Predator 12 4.04%
Hypertech Programmer 21 7.07%
Banks Six Gun 26 8.75%
TS Performance 4Bank Chip 71 23.91%
Voters: 297. You may not vote on this poll
